American Plum

American plum, also called Wild plum is a small, fast-growing, short-lived, colony-forming native tree, commonly found along fencerows, open fields, and roadsides. Abundant tiny white flowers open before the leaves emerge in spring. Plums appear in late summer. The American plum is a small, deciduous single or multi-stemmed shrub. It is fast-growing and short-lived, typically from 15 to 30 years. Tiny pinkish-white flowers are abundant in the spring and have an unpleasant odor. Plums with a pink to red outer skin form in the late spring. Family (English)Ros. Family (botanic)Rosaceae. Planting site: Residential and parks, Under utility lines; American plum prefers well-drained moist soils but can also tolerate alkaline, acidic, and clay soils. It can also tolerate dry sites, salt spray, poor drainage, wet sites, and drought. It is typically found growing along roadsides, fields, and fence rows. American plums are also seen as aggressive and can be high maintenance due to their excessive sucker growth and the ability to grow in thickets. Foliage: Deciduous (seasonally loses leaves). Native locale: North America. Size range: Small tree (15-25 feet). Mature height: 15-25 feet. Mature width: 15-25 feet. Light exposure: Full sun (6 hrs direct light daily), Partial sun / shade (4-6 hrs light daily). Hardiness zones: Zone 3 – 8. Soil preference: Moist, well-drained soil. Tolerances: Alkaline soil, Clay soil, Dry sites, Wet sites. Season of interest: Early spring, mid spring, early fall, mid fall. Flower color and fragrance: White. Shape or form: Thicket-forming. Growth rate: Moderate. Transplants well: Yes. Planting considerations: Aggressive, Excessive sucker growth. Wildlife: Birds, Browsers, Insect pollinators, Medium mammals, Small mammals.
